S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R REFINING CANNABIDIOL

A method of making CBD concentrate or CBD Isolate comprises (a) milling a raw material; (b) contacting the milled raw material with an extraction solvent and separating a solid waste material to form a filtered extract; (c) concentrating the filtered extract; (d) washing the concentrated extract to form an organic phase and an aqueous phase; (e) separating the aqueous phase from the organic phase to form a washed extract; (f) removing an organic solvent from the washed extract to form a concentrated washed extract; (g) decarboxylating the concentrated washed extract; (h) vacuum distilling the decarboxylated extract to form a distillate; (i) dewaxing the distillate to form a post-dewax filtrate; (j) applying a vacuum to the post-dewax filtrate to form a post-dewax concentrate; (k) degassing the post-dewax concentrate; and (l) vacuum distilling the degassed concentrate to form a CBD concentrate.

Methods of isolating phenols from phenol-containing media

Methods of isolating phenols from phenol-containing media. The methods include combining a phospholipid-containing composition with the phenol-containing medium to generate a combined medium, incubating the combined medium to precipitate phenols in the combined medium and thereby form a phenol precipitate phase and a phenol-depleted phase, and separating the phenol precipitate phase and the phenol-depleted phase. The methods can further include extracting phenols from the separated phenol precipitate phase. The extracting can include mixing the separated phenol precipitate phase with an extraction solvent to solubilize in the extraction solvent at least a portion of the phenols originally present in the phenol precipitate phase.

Method of converting delta9-THC to delta10-THC and the purification of the delta10-THC by crystallization
11542243 · 2023-01-03 ·

A method of isomerizing Δ9-tetrahydrocannabinol (“Δ9-THC”) to Δ10-tetrahydrocannabinol (“Δ10-THC”). The method includes the steps of: extracting Δ9-THC from cannabis biomass, which optionally contains one or more of the components found in fire retardant such as PHOS-CHEK®; dewaxing of crude extracts by winterization; pH-adjusting extracts by washing the extracts in heptane solution with aqueous solutions of: citric acid, sodium bicarbonate, and brine; isomerizing Δ9-THC to Δ10-THC by exposure to suitable conditions and in the presence of a catalyst based on the components of fire retardant; vacuum distillation of Δ10-THC at a predetermined temperature range and vacuum level; collecting the distillate and redistilling it up to three times to acquire distillate containing less than 60% Δ10-THC; and purification of the MO-THC to a purity of 99% or greater by crystallization from n-pentane solution.

USE OF SOLUTIONS OF CANNABINOIDS FOR IMPROVING CANNABINOID PRODUCTION IN CANNABIS PLANTS TREATED THEREWITH

Methods for increasing cannabinoid production in growing cannabis plants, and for lowering the hydrophobicity of soil are described. Foliar application of compositions comprising cannabinoids extracted from Cannabis sativa hemp to the growing plants and/or drenching the soil surrounding the growing cannabis plants therewith have been demonstrated to produce significant changes in cannabinoid production, thereby generating an increase in the marketable portion of the crop. Additionally, application of these compositions to the soil reduces soil hydrophobicity.

PROCESS AND APPARATUS FOR MULTI-PHASE EXTRACTION OF ACTIVE SUBSTANCES FROM BIOMASS

A method for performing a multi-phase extraction of plant biomass to obtain active substances is provided. The method uses a novel freeze-dry extraction technique to obtain a volatile terpene fraction from frozen plant material. In particular, the method disclosed provides terpene extracts with compositions that strongly resemble that of the parent plant material.

Systems and methods for cannabis extraction

This disclosure provides methods and systems for the supercritical fluid extraction of cannabinoids from cannabis. The supercritical fluid extraction of cannabinoids is performed with carbon dioxide (CO.sub.2) balanced with one or more hydrocarbons, such as propane, propene, and propadiene. As demonstrated, the extraction can be carried out at maximum efficiency and energy savings while keeping the wax formation at minimum by lowering temperature. The methods and systems disclosed herein reduce the production time and safety/environmental hazards and are suitable for proper and safe extraction in non-GMP and GMP environments.
